Scientists could have discovered a robust new house object: ‘It does not match comfortably into any identified class’


A bewilderingly highly effective thriller object present in a close-by galaxy and solely seen to this point in millimeter radio wavelengths may very well be a model new astrophysical object in contrast to something astronomers have seen earlier than.

The article has been named ‘Punctum,’ derived from the Latin pūnctum that means “level” or
“dot,” by a workforce of astronomers led by Elena Shablovinskaia of the Instituto de Estudios Astrofísicos on the Universidad Diego Portales in Chile. Shablovinskaia found it utilizing ALMA, the Atacama Massive Millimeter/submillimeter Array.
